Description
Two 19th century Indian arrows, with steel arrowheads, bamboo shafts, flared nocks, binding for the fletchings (which are no longer present) and remnants of painted decoration to the binding. Where the fletchings were originally glued to the shafts it is evident that one arrow had four feathers and the other had three. Lengths 68cm and 75cm from point to nock. Together with twenty tanged arrowheads in various shapes and sizes.
